Hardin County School District Statistics

The Hardin County School District is located in Savannah, TN and includes 10 schools that serve 3,967 students in grades PK through 12.  

District Spending

The Hardin County School District spends $6,493 per pupil in current expenditures.  The district spends 65% on instruction, 27% on support services, and 8% on other elementary and secondary expenditures.

District Student-Teacher Ratio

The Hardin County School District has 14 students for every full-time equivalent teacher, with the TN state average being 16 students per full-time equivalent teacher.  

District Student Information

The Hardin County School District had a grades 9-12 dropout rate of 5% in 2005.  The national grades 9-12 dropout rate in 2005 was 3.9%.  

In the Hardin County School District, 12% of students have an IEP (Individualized Education Program).  An IEP is a written plan for students eligible for special needs services.  

Source: NCES, 2005-2006
